Some psychotherapeutic schools discribe their techniques in precise step-by-step formats. By
using these methods for decades the practitioner recognizes patterns in psychological phenomena
that are hard to see in controlled laboratory settings. What does the regarding of such highly
structured therapeutic techniques as field experiements reveal about the workings of the mind?
In this project the focus is on insights about the role of space in cognition, the mechanisms that
make it hard for people to change their beliefs, and the neuro-cognitive mechanisms behind
emotional problem solving. Lucas Derks' research opens a new paradigm in psychology: Mental Space Psychology.
